Displaying Manipulators in the Player
You must enable the display of manipulators in the Player view or in the
fullscreen Player to see manipulators related to individual tools. Manipulators
for individual tools include the eyedropper for the Color Picker, axes in the
Reaction tool, and control points in the Garbage Mask tool.
NOTE You can enable the display of manipulators in the fullscreen Player only if
you entered it through a Player view.
To display manipulators in the Player:
1 In the Player view or fullscreen Player, middle-click or press the tilde key
(~) to display the Gate UI and go through the south gate.
2 In the Display tab of the Player options, select Manipulators (at the
bottom of the Guides area).
